  • The smooth time-varying constraint is a mechanical effect of continuous contact produced by the rubbing between rotor and stator, in which the periodic time-varying constraint is applied to the rotor. The additional stiffness curve caused by contact between the stator and the rotor is a smooth and derivable function with time. A smooth time-varying constraint model is established based on the orbit of rotor in experiment, and the modal frequency, stability and response of rotor system with smooth time-varying constraint are analyzed based on the Hill method, which provides an analysis frame for the fault identification and stability analysis of the rubbing rotor. The research results show that the rotor with smooth time-varying constraint has the characteristics of frequency coupling, multi-frequency and instability. In the unstable speed region, the amplitude of the rotor gradually increases with time. The frequency component that causes the instability of the rotor system is the frequency component whose real part of eigenvalue is greater than 0 in the rotor modal analysis. In the stable speed region, the rotor's frequency response is mainly the frequency combination composed of speed frequency and contact frequency.
